More about the book
The book explores significant theories in Translation Studies developed over the past five decades, emphasizing innovative perspectives from outside North America and Europe. It addresses the impact of recent technological advancements on translation practices and examines the evolving nature of theoretical frameworks within the field. This comprehensive approach provides a global and contemporary understanding of translation theory.
